• Ex-CT Budget Official Flees Country Before Sentencing In Corruption Case (patch.com) — Farmington resident Konstantinos "Kosta" Diamantis, a former top state budget and school construction official, has fled to Greece before his federal sentencing on corruption charges, prompting a bench warrant. Prosecutors say he took bribes from contractors seeking lucrative school construction work, while the state attorney general is now moving to revoke his pension. His sentencing has been rescheduled for Sept. 30 in Bridgeport federal court.

• Mike Tyson/50 Cent Farmington Mansion Still On The Market (patch.com) — Farmington readers can take a fresh look inside the massive Poplar Hill Drive estate once owned by Mike Tyson and 50 Cent, still listed for $9.9 million. The story details its 51,830 square feet of living space, lavish amenities from indoor pools to a nightclub and recording studio, and the hefty local tax bill tied to this high-profile Farmington property.
